'Protect Shifnal': Campaigners' plea amid latest housing plans for the town

Campaigners have raised fresh concerns over the scale of house-building planned for Shifnal.

The comments from Shifnal Matters come as the town is the focus of a number of housing plans - with more than 250 fresh houses planned.

There are currently four proposals at various stages.

They include plans from Catesby Estates for around 200 homes on 16 acres of agricultural land at New Park Farm to the north of Revells Rough, and to the southeast of the town

The site sits next to an existing Taylor Wimpey development known as the Thomas Beddoes estate.

Taylor Wimpey itself is proposing a further 57 homes on land to the south of the Thomas Beddoes estate.
